How We Run the bKash Payzone

We keep the bKash Payzone straightforward — no hidden steps, no undisclosed fees on our side. Every deposit and withdrawal request is logged against your account ID, and our payment team reviews flagged transactions before they clear.

Verified Wallet Matching

Your bKash number must match the mobile number registered on your 67bd account. This one-to-one check prevents misdirected payments and keeps your withdrawal path clean.

Transaction Logging

Every bKash deposit and withdrawal request is recorded with a timestamp and reference. You can view your transaction history from the account wallet screen at any time.

KYC Before Withdrawal

KYC — Know Your Customer — verification is required before your first bKash withdrawal. You submit a valid ID once; after approval, future withdrawals process without repeating the step.

No Third-Party Wallets

We only send withdrawals to the bKash number on your registered account. Requests to send funds to a different number are declined as a standard account-security measure.

Inside the bKash Payzone Flow

To fund your account through the bKash Payzone, open your bKash app, select Send Money, enter the account number shown on the 67bd deposit screen, and confirm with your PIN. The reference number from that screen goes into the transaction note. Once the transfer is sent, your 67bd wallet balance updates after our payment team confirms the incoming transaction. Withdrawals follow the

same path in reverse — you request from your account, we send to your registered bKash number. Players in Dhaka and across Bangladesh use this route as their primary account funding method. Nagad and Rocket follow a near-identical flow if you prefer either of those wallets.

bKash Payzone Terms Explained

Short definitions for the account and payment terms you will see while using the bKash Payzone on 67bd.

What is a deposit reference number?

A short code generated on the 67bd deposit screen. You paste it into the bKash transaction note so our system can match your incoming payment to your account automatically.

What does wallet verification mean?

The step where we confirm your bKash number matches your registered account mobile number. Verification is required once and unlocks the withdrawal path on your account.

What is KYC in this context?

KYC stands for Know Your Customer. It is a one-time identity check — usually a national ID scan — required before your first withdrawal is processed from the bKash Payzone.

What is a payment batch?

A scheduled processing window in which multiple withdrawal requests are grouped and sent together. Your bKash withdrawal enters the next available batch after your account verification clears.

What does 'pending' mean on a bKash deposit?

Pending means the payment has been received but not yet matched to your account. It usually resolves once our team confirms the reference number against the incoming transfer.

What is a transaction ID?

A unique code bKash assigns to every Send Money transfer. It is your proof of payment and the key reference our support team uses to trace any deposit that does not clear automatically.
